The Shifting Foundations of Mannequin Functionality
Whereas early beneficial properties in LLM efficiency tracked carefully with will increase in pretraining compute, bigger datasets, larger fashions, and extra coaching steps, this method now yields diminishing returns.
Latest enhancements come from a broader mixture of methods. Pretraining-data high quality has grow to be simply as vital as amount, with higher filtering and AI-generated artificial information contributing to stronger fashions. Architectural effectivity, just like the improvements launched by DeepSeek, has began to shut the hole between measurement and functionality. And post-training methods, particularly instruction tuning and reinforcement studying from human or AI suggestions (RLHF/RLAIF), have made fashions extra aligned, controllable, and responsive in observe.
The extra basic shift, nonetheless, is going on at inference time. Since late 2024, with fashions like OpenAI’s o1, we’ve entered a brand new section the place fashions can commerce compute for reasoning on demand. Slightly than relying solely on what was baked in throughout coaching, they will now “suppose tougher” at runtime, working extra inner steps, exploring different solutions, or chaining ideas earlier than responding. This opens up new functionality ceilings, but in addition introduces new value dynamics.
These diversified enchancment methods have led to a transparent divergence amongst AI labs and fashions, a speedy enlargement in mannequin selection, and in some instances, an explosion in mannequin utilization prices.
The Trendy Value Explosion: How Inference Scaling Modified the Sport
Inference-time compute scaling has launched a brand new dynamic in LLM system design: We’ve gone from a single lever mannequin measurement, to no less than 4 distinct methods to commerce value for functionality at runtime. The result’s a widening hole in inference value throughout fashions and use instances, generally by elements of 10,000x or extra.
Bigger Fashions (Dimension Scaling): The obvious lever is sheer mannequin measurement. Frontier LLMs, like GPT-4.5, typically constructed with combination of consultants (MoE) architectures, can have enter token prices 750 occasions larger than streamlined fashions like Gemini Flash-Lite. Bigger parameter counts imply extra compute per token, particularly when a number of consultants are lively per question.
Sequence Scaling (“Pondering Tokens”): Newer “reasoning” LLMs carry out extra inner computational steps, or an extended chain of thought, earlier than producing their last reply. For instance, OpenAI’s o1 used ~30x extra compute than GPT-4o on common, and infrequently 5x extra output tokens per process. Agentic techniques introduce an extra technique of collection scaling and an additional layer of value multiplication. As these brokers suppose, plan, act, reassess, plan, act, and so forth, they typically make many LLM steps in a loop, every incurring further value.
Parallel Scaling: Right here, the system runs a number of mannequin situations on the identical process after which mechanically selects the perfect output by way of automated strategies, corresponding to majority voting (which assumes the most typical reply is probably going right) or self-confidence scores (the place the mannequin output claiming the very best confidence in its response is taken as the perfect). The o3-pro mannequin probably runs 5–10x parallel situations over o3. This multiplies the price by the variety of parallel makes an attempt (with some nuance).
Enter Context Scaling: In RAG pipelines, the variety of retrieved chunks and their measurement straight affect enter token prices and the LLM’s potential to synthesize reply. Extra context can typically enhance outcomes, however this comes at a better value and potential latency. Context isn’t free; it’s one other dimension of scaling that builders should funds for.
Taken collectively, these 4 elements characterize a basic shift in how mannequin value scales. For builders designing techniques for high-value issues, 10,000x to 1,000,000x variations in API prices to resolve an issue based mostly on architectural decisions are actually sensible prospects. Reasoning LLMs, though solely distinguished for about 9 months, reversed the development of declining entry prices to the easiest fashions. This transforms the choice from “Which LLM ought to I exploit?” to incorporate “How a lot reasoning do I need to pay for?”
This shift modifications how we take into consideration choice. Selecting an LLM is now not about chasing the very best benchmark rating; it’s about discovering the steadiness level the place functionality, latency, and value align together with your use case.

The Execs and Cons of Open-Weight and Closed API LLMs
The rise of more and more aggressive open-weight LLMs, corresponding to Meta’s Llama collection, Mistral, DeepSeek, Gemma, Qwen, and now OpenAI’s GPT-OSS has added a crucial dimension to the mannequin choice panorama. Momentum behind this open ecosystem surged with the discharge of DeepSeek’s R1 reasoning mannequin, aggressive with OpenAI’s o1 however priced at roughly 30x decrease API prices. This sparked debate round effectivity versus scale and intensified the broader AI rivalry between China and the US. Reactions ranged from “OpenAI and Nvidia are out of date” to “DeepSeek’s prices have to be fabricated,” however no matter hype, the discharge was a milestone. It confirmed that architectural innovation, not simply scale, may ship frontier-level efficiency with far better value effectivity.
This open-model offensive has continued with sturdy contributions from different Chinese language labs like Alibaba (Qwen), Kimi, and Tencent (Hunyuan), and has put aggressive strain on Meta after its open-weight Llama fashions fell behind. China’s latest management in Open Weight LLMs has raised new safety/IP points with some US and European based mostly organizations, although we word accessing these mannequin weights and working the mannequin by yourself infrastructure doesn’t require sending information to China.
This brings us again to the professionals and cons of open weights. Whereas Closed API LLMs nonetheless lead on the frontier of functionality, the first benefit of open weights fashions is fast and reasonably priced native testing, unparalleled flexibility, and elevated information safety when run internally. Organizations may also carry out full fine-tuning, adapting the mannequin’s core weights and behaviors to their particular area, language, and duties. Open fashions additionally present stability and predictability; you management the model you deploy, insulating your manufacturing techniques from sudden modifications or degradations that may generally happen with unannounced updates to proprietary API-based fashions.
Public closed mannequin APIs from main suppliers profit from immense economies of scale and extremely optimized GPU utilization by batching requests from 1000’s of customers, an effectivity that’s troublesome for a single group to duplicate. This typically implies that utilizing a closed-source API may be cheaper per inference than self-hosting an open mannequin. Safety and compliance are additionally extra nuanced than they first seem. Whereas some organizations should use self-hosted fashions to simplify compliance with rules like GDPR by protecting information solely inside their very own perimeter, this locations your entire burden of securing the infrastructure on the inner group—a fancy and costly endeavor. Prime API suppliers additionally typically supply devoted situations, personal cloud endpoints, and contractual agreements that may assure information residency, zero-logging, and meet stringent regulatory requirements. The selection, subsequently, shouldn’t be a easy open-versus-closed binary.
The boundary between open and closed fashions can be turning into more and more blurred. Open-weight fashions are more and more supplied by way of API by third-party LLM inference platforms, combining the flexibleness of open fashions with the simplicity of hosted entry. This hybrid method typically strikes a sensible steadiness between management and operational complexity.

Step 4: Prompting, then RAG, then Analysis
Earlier than you dive into extra complicated and expensive growth, all the time see how far you will get with the best methods. This can be a path of escalating complexity. Mannequin selection for RAG pipelines is commonly centered round latency for finish customers, however just lately extra complicated agentic RAG workflows or lengthy context RAG duties require reasoning fashions or longer context capabilities.
- Immediate Engineering First: Your first step is all the time to maximise the mannequin’s inherent capabilities by clear, well-structured prompting. Usually, a greater immediate with a extra succesful mannequin is all you want.
- Transfer to Retrieval-Augmented Technology (RAG): In case your mannequin’s limitation is an absence of particular, personal, or up-to-date information, RAG is the following logical step. That is the perfect method for lowering hallucinations, offering solutions based mostly on proprietary paperwork, and making certain responses are present. Nonetheless, RAG shouldn’t be a panacea. Its effectiveness is solely depending on the standard and freshness of your dataset, and constructing a retrieval system that constantly finds and makes use of the most related info is a major engineering problem. RAG additionally comes with many related choices, corresponding to the amount of information to retrieve and feed into the mannequin’s context window, and simply how a lot you make use of lengthy context capabilities and context caching.
- Iterate with Superior RAG: To push efficiency, you have to to implement extra superior methods like hybrid search (combining key phrase and vector search), re-ranking retrieved outcomes for relevance, and question transformation.
- Construct Customized Analysis: Guarantee iterations in your system design, additions of recent superior RAG methods, or updates to the newest mannequin are all the time shifting progress ahead in your key metrics!
Step 5: Fantastic-Tune or Distill for Deep Specialization
If the mannequin’s core conduct—not its information—remains to be the issue, then it’s time to think about fine-tuning. Fantastic-tuning is a major endeavor that requires a high-quality dataset, engineering effort, and computational assets. Nonetheless, it will probably allow a smaller, cheaper open-weight mannequin to outperform an enormous generalist mannequin on a particular, slim process, making it a strong device for optimization and specialization.
- Fantastic-tuning is for altering conduct, not including information. Use it to show a mannequin a particular ability, model, or format. For instance:
- To reliably output information in a fancy, structured format like particular JSON or XML schemas.
- To grasp the distinctive vocabulary and nuances of a extremely specialised area (e.g., authorized, medical).
- Some Closed Supply Fashions can be found for tremendous tuning by way of API corresponding to Gemini 2.5 Flash and varied OpenAI fashions. Bigger fashions are usually not obtainable.
- In Open Weights fashions Llama 3.3 70B and Qwen 70B are Fantastic-tuning Staples. The method is extra complicated to fine-tune an open weight mannequin your self.
- Mannequin distillation may also function a production-focused optimization step. In its easiest kind, this consists of producing artificial information from bigger fashions to create fine-tuning information units to enhance the capabilities of smaller fashions.
- Reinforcement Fantastic-Tuning (RFT) for Downside-Fixing Accuracy.
As a substitute of simply imitating right solutions, the mannequin learns by trial, error, and correction. It’s rewarded for getting solutions proper and penalized for getting them improper.- Use RFT to: Create a real “professional mannequin” that excels at complicated duties with objectively right outcomes.
- The Benefit: RFT is extremely data-efficient, typically requiring just a few dozen high-quality examples to attain vital efficiency beneficial properties.
- The Catch: RFT requires a dependable, automated “grader” to supply the reward sign. Designing this grader is a crucial engineering problem.
Step 6: Orchestrated Workflows Versus Autonomous Brokers
The crucial determination right here is how a lot freedom to grant. Autonomous brokers are additionally extra more likely to want dearer reasoning fashions with better ranges of inference scaling. Parallel inference scaling strategies with a number of brokers are additionally starting to ship nice outcomes. Small errors can accumulate and multiply throughout many successive agentic steps so the funding in a stronger extra succesful mannequin could make all of the distinction in constructing a usable product.
- Select an Orchestrated Workflow for Predictable Duties. You design a particular, typically linear, sequence of steps, and the LLM acts as a strong element at a number of of these steps.
- Use when: You might be automating a recognized, repeatable enterprise course of (e.g., processing a buyer help ticket, producing a month-to-month monetary abstract). The aim is reliability, predictability, and management.
- Profit: You preserve full management over the method, making certain consistency and managing prices successfully as a result of the quantity and kind of LLM calls are predefined.
- Construct hybrid pipelines: Usually, the perfect outcomes will come from combining many LLMs, open and closed, inside a pipeline.
- This implies utilizing completely different LLMs for various levels of a workflow: a quick, low-cost LLM for preliminary question routing; a specialised LLM for a particular sub-task; a strong reasoning LLM for complicated planning; and maybe one other LLM for verification or refinement.
- At In direction of AI, we regularly have 2-3 completely different LLMs from completely different firms in an LLM pipeline.
- Select an Autonomous Agent for Open-Ended Issues. You give the LLM a high-level aim, a set of instruments (e.g., APIs, databases, code interpreters), and the autonomy to determine the steps to attain that aim.
- Use when: The trail to the answer is unknown and requires dynamic problem-solving, exploration, or analysis (e.g., debugging a fancy software program concern, performing deep market evaluation, planning a multistage mission).
- The Essential Threat—Runaway Prices: An agent that will get caught in a loop, makes poor choices, or explores inefficient paths can quickly accumulate monumental API prices. Implementing strict guardrails is crucial:
- Price range Limits: Set exhausting caps on the price per process.
- Step Counters: Restrict the full variety of “ideas” or “actions” an agent can take.
- Human-in-the-Loop: Require human approval for probably costly or irreversible actions.
- o3 and Gemini 2.5 Professional are our favorite closed API fashions for Agent pipelines whereas in open weights fashions we like Kimi K2.
